Appetizingly Yours Events and Catering

Ingrid von Cube the President and Creative Director, of Appetizingly Yours (AY) has been servicing Guelph and the surrounding area for the past 20 years. AY partners with a network of farmers and suppliers to provide clients with daily deliveries of the freshest seasonal ingredi-ents, from organic produce to naturally raised meats. Ingrid believes in supporting local growers and farmers however possible, designing the AY menus around the incredible products our area has to offer. www.appyours.com

Yasser Qahawish, Chef/owner of Artisanale is extremely passion-ate about French food and culture. He has trained with top chefs in Toronto, Montreal and at a few Michelin-rated restaurants in France. The focus of our restaurant is an “ingredient-based” menu. We have great respect and appreciation for farmers, and we spend a great deal of time sourcing ingredients which have been sustainably and respon-sibly produced. We are a truly seasonal restaurant and we are proud to feature food products found locally. www.artisanale.ca

Whole Circle Farm is the first of our suppliers that has committed to providing fresh organic food to our restaurant. They have dedicated a portion of their land solely to growing produce from seeds hand-picked by our chef from a heritage seed catalogue. This pilot program is a great example of the partnership that farms and restaurants can maintain. Artisanale’s partnership with Whole Circle Farm serves the community by providing quality locally-produced food. www.wholecirclefarm.ca

Borealis GrilleJim Loat attended chef school and trained intensively as an apprentice at various restaurants, earning an Honours degree in Hotel and Food Administration. He has made appearances in magazines, cookbooks, television and radio.

Currently Jim is head chef at the Borealis Grille, Guelph’s first Sa-vour Ontario restaurant. The concept features local Ontario prod-ucts almost exclusively on the menus and wine lists. Over the years, Jim has been honoured to serve celebrities, world class musicians, sports stars and past prime ministers. www.borealisgrille.ca

Neil Vandendool is the owner and operator of Ontario Harvest Farms and the Rising Star Elk farm, located near Rockwood. Ontario Harvest has become a thriving business, distributing locally produced specialty meats to area restaurants. Neil has partnered with a wide variety of Ontario producers and processors with a focus on game, fowl, heritage and naturally raised meats. Ontario Harvest provides Wellington County’s finest artisan chefs, such as the Borealis Grill, with unique flavourful products. Neil is strongly committed to ethical, sustainable agriculture and the environment we all share. www.harvestontario.com

F&M BreweryF&M micro brewery takes the care and quality process one step further, and, in combination with the pure water found only in the artesian wells of Guelph, F&M uses only the highest quality malted barley and fresh hops in their ales and lagers. www.fmbrewery.com

With two locations in Guelph, Planet Bean Coffee is committed to creating great tasting gourmet coffee through fair trade and links between consumers and producers. Planet Bean offers over a dozen fresh roasted, gourmet coffees.

This perfect pairing can now be enjoyed in liquid form. This season order a StoneHammer Oatmeal Coffee Stout at select venues in Guelph. This beer will be the first in Canada to have the Transfair Canada seal of fair trade authentication because the coffee used in the flavouring of the stout is fair trade certified.

“It is the kind of partnership between Guelph small businesses that can help us weather the economic storm.”

Byron Cunningham – Planet Bean

We insist on things like 100% Canadian grown two-row barley malt, English hops, a continually cultured strain of yeast and Arkell Springs water.

www.wellingtonbrewery.ca

Since our brewery opened in 1985, we’ve even insisted that our fine English Ales have to be brewed using English brewing equipment. Ours was built by Hickley of London specifically for Wellington Brewery.
